android:layout_above 将该控件的底部置于给定ID的控件之上
android:layout_below 将该空间的顶部置于给定ID的控件之下
android:layout_toLeftOf 将该控件的右边缘和给定ID的控件的左边缘对齐
android:layout_toRightOf 将该控件的左边缘和给定ID的控件的右边缘对齐
android:layout_alignBaseLine 将该控件的baseline和给定ID的控件的baseline对齐
android:layout_alignBottom 将该控件的底部边缘与给定ID的控件的底部边缘对齐
android:layout_alignLeft 将该控件的左边缘与给定ID的控件的左边缘对齐
android:layout_alignRight 将该控件的右边缘与给定ID的控件的右边缘对齐
android:layout_alignTop 将该控件的顶部边缘与给定ID的控件的顶部边缘对齐
android:layout_alignParentBottom 如果该值为true,则将该控件的底部和父控件的底部对齐
android:layout_alignLeft 如果改值为true,则将该控件的左边与父控件的左边对齐
android:layout_alignRight 如果改值为true,则将该控件的右边与父控件的右边对齐
android:layout_alignParentTop 如果改值为true,则将该控件的顶部与父控件的顶部对齐
android:layout_centerHorizontal 如果该值为true,该控件将被置于水平方向的中央
android:layout_centerInParent 如果该值为true,该控件将被置于父控件水平方向和垂直方向的中央
android:layout_centerVertical 如果该值为true,该控件将被置于垂直方向的中央
分享到:
相关推荐
下面我们将详细探讨RelativeLayout的常用属性及其作用。 1. **android:gravity**:此属性用于设置布局容器内所有子组件的对齐方式。它可以是"left"、"right"、"top"、"bottom"、"center"、"center_horizontal"或...
Android 布局属性 RelativeLayout 是 Android 中常用的布局方式之一,通过它可以实现复杂的界面布局。下面是 RelativeLayout 的主要属性详解: 第一类:属性值为 true 或 false 1. android:layout_...
第一类:属性值为true或false 第二类:属性值必须为id的引用名"@+id/name" 第三类:属性值为具体的值,如20dp,30dp,40dp
`RelativeLayout.LayoutParams`是用于定义视图在`RelativeLayout`中的布局属性的类。每个视图需要这些参数来决定其大小和位置。开发者可以创建并设置这些参数,以便在运行时动态改变视图的位置。 5. **使用示例:*...
`RelativeLayout`作为常用的布局之一,提供了相对于其他视图或父容器定位视图的能力。本文将深入探讨`RelativeLayout`的关键属性及其应用场景。 #### RelativeLayout简介 `RelativeLayout`允许通过指定与父容器或...
下面将详细介绍帧布局FrameLayout的常用属性。 1. **Android:foreground** 这个属性用于设置帧布局的前景图,即在所有子视图之上显示的图像。前景图可以是任何图形资源,如图片、形状等。通过这个属性,可以在...
在Android应用开发中,RelativeLayout是一种常用的布局管理器,它允许我们根据相对位置来安排View组件。这个"Android应用源码之12.RelativeLayout.zip"压缩包很可能是为了教学或研究目的,提供了一个使用...
在Android开发中,布局管理器是构建用户界面的关键组件,其中`RelativeLayout`是最常用和灵活的布局之一。本文将深入探讨`RelativeLayout`的基本用法,包括它的特点、优点以及如何在XML布局文件中配置和使用它。 `...
Android的相对布局(RelativeLayout)是Android开发中常用的一种布局方式,它允许子视图相对于其他视图或父视图进行定位。在这个文档中,我们将深入探讨RelativeLayout的基本属性及其使用。 一、属性值为true或...
在`RelativeLayout`中,可以通过`android:id`属性为每个视图分配一个唯一的ID,然后在其他视图的属性中引用这个ID,实现视图间的相对定位。此外,还可以使用`android:layout_width`和`android:layout_height`来控制...
`RelativeLayout`是Android开发中常用的一种布局管理器,它允许开发者在界面上按照相对位置来排列各个View组件。在这个布局中,每个控件的位置可以相对于其他控件或者父布局进行定位,提供了高度灵活的界面设计能力...
### Java相对布局常用属性 在Android开发中,相对布局(RelativeLayout)是一种非常常见的布局方式,它允许开发者根据屏幕尺寸灵活地定位控件。通过设置不同的属性,可以实现控件之间的相对位置关系,使得UI设计...
#### 四、其他常用属性 除了上述属性外,还有一些其他的属性用于进一步优化布局: - **`android:hint`**: 设置`EditText`为空时的提示信息。 - **`android:gravity`**: 控制视图内容(如文本)在视图中的对齐方式...
本篇将详细解释`RelativeLayout`的特性和常用属性,以及如何通过这些属性实现组件的相对定位。 ### 1. `RelativeLayout`概述 `RelativeLayout`是一个布局容器,其内部的子视图(views)的位置不是根据绝对坐标,...
在Android开发中,RelativeLayout是一种常用的布局管理器,它允许我们以相对的方式排列控件,比如一个控件相对于另一个控件的位置。在这个“应用源码之12.RelativeLayout.zip”压缩包中,我们可以深入学习如何在实际...
在Android应用开发中,界面设计是至关重要的一步,而`RelativeLayout`是Android提供的一种常用的布局管理器,它允许我们以相对的方式定位各个UI组件。这篇练习题旨在帮助开发者熟悉并掌握`RelativeLayout`的使用方法...
在Android应用开发中,`RelativeLayout` 是一个常用的布局管理器,它允许开发者通过相对位置来组织界面元素。这种布局方式提供了灵活的定位机制,可以根据一个视图相对于另一个视图的位置来确定每个视图的位置。在...
在Android开发中,相对布局(`RelativeLayout`)是一种常用的布局方式,它允许子视图根据其他视图的位置进行定位,或者相对于父容器进行定位。通过使用相对布局,开发者可以创建出灵活且适应性强的用户界面。本文将...
在Android开发中,`RadioGroup`是一个常用的布局控件,用于管理一组单选按钮(RadioButton)。通常,`RadioGroup`会使得其内的单选按钮只能有一个被选中。然而,有时候开发者可能希望实现类似`RelativeLayout`那样更...